Hi out there. The North Florida Railroad Museum is alive and well. We still have equipment in our ownership but not as much we did. We were complelled to sell off some of the cars and other stuff in order to stay solvent. CSX required that we vacate their RR but they would only move that equipment that had roller bearings. We have relocated to the industrial park at Green Cove Springs. We have 6 peices of equipment remaining. Please feel free to contact me if you need any additional information.
